#2643f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2643f4 is composed of 14.9% red, 26.3%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 72.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 231.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 55.3%. #2643f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c86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#2643f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2643f4 has RGB values of R:38, G:67,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2507764.

Shades and Tints of #2643f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000107 is the darkest color, while #f3f5fe is the lightest one.
